logo

Output d95759e32f83339b683608d1eec1c6f576a181d5c8394db6701717cc4af53fc6:0

value
23088750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bcc0386068b78d0eb54f13f42e85dd07babc318 OP_EQUALVERIFY OP_CHECKSIG
address
14zaTNfYADHV9vKkPwKa1FomK7N2E13BjS
transaction
d95759e32f83339b683608d1eec1c6f576a181d5c8394db6701717cc4af53fc6